Artist's Description
French poet and adventurer, who stopped writing verse at the age of 21, became after his early death an inextricable myth in French world of poetry and culture. He was the enfant terrible of French poetry in the second half of the nineteenth century and a major figure in symbolism.
This portrait of Arthur Rimbaud when he was seventeen is a digitally modified version of the photograph taken by Étienne Carjat in c.1872.
